IF ARRESTED
If you have been charged in a criminal matter, keep in mind that the
less you say about it to anyone, the better off your defense will be.
You have Miranda rights and you should not be intimidated by police
officers, or anyone else, into giving them up. Whether you are an adult
citizen or non-citizen, you have certain rights if you are arrested.
Before a law enforcement officer questions you, he or she should give
you your Miranda Warnings.:
- You have the right to remain silent.
- Anything you say can and will be used against you.
- You have the right to have an attorney present while you are
questioned.
- If you cannot afford an attorney, one will be appointed for you.
Just say that you want to speak with your attorney before you answer
any other questions. Then, call an attorney and see him as soon as possible.
Once you are booked into custody you have a right to make and complete
three phone calls that are free within the local calling area.
